US Patent Application 17752749. GENERATING METADATA TO FACILITATE CODE GENERATION simplified abstract

From WikiPatents
Jump to navigation Jump to search

GENERATING METADATA TO FACILITATE CODE GENERATION

Organization Name

Red Hat, Inc.

Inventor(s)

Edoardo Vacchi of Milan (IT)

Paolo Antinori of Milan (IT)

GENERATING METADATA TO FACILITATE CODE GENERATION - A simplified explanation of the abstract

This abstract first appeared for US patent application 17752749 titled 'GENERATING METADATA TO FACILITATE CODE GENERATION

Simplified Explanation

The patent application describes a method for generating metadata to aid in code generation.

  • The method involves receiving two files, each containing information about different sets of components in different notation syntaxes.
  • The first file and the second file are cross-validated to ensure that a reference from a component in the first set to a component in the second set is valid.
  • A metadata file is generated, containing identification information about the valid reference.
  • Code is then generated based on the metadata file, the first file, and the second file, which can be executed.


Original Abstract Submitted

In various examples disclosed herein, provided is a method for generating metadata to facilitate code generation. The method can include receiving a first file that includes information relating to a first set of components in a first notation syntax and a second file that includes information relating to a second set of components in a second notation syntax. The method can also include cross-validating the first file and the second file to determine that a first reference, in a first component of the first set of components, to a second component of the second set of components is valid. The method can also include generating a first metadata file that includes identification information relating to the first reference. The method can also include generating code to be executed based on the first metadata file, the first file, and the second file.